Subfloor Replacement in Wilmington, NC
Subfloor replacement services involve removing and installing new subflooring material beneath existing flooring to ensure a stable and level foundation. This service is commonly requested for projects involving water damage, wood rot, mold issues, or uneven flooring surfaces. Property owners should understand the importance of inspecting the subfloor for signs of damage or deterioration, as issues in this layer can affect the overall integrity of the flooring above and may lead to further problems if left unaddressed.
Before requesting subfloor replacement, homeowners typically want to know about the scope of work involved, the types of materials used, and the potential impact on their existing flooring. It's also helpful to understand the reasons for replacement, such as moisture problems or structural concerns, and whether the work will require any additional repairs to the flooring or underlying structures.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ure the new subfloor provides a solid, long-lasting foundation for the finished floor.

Signs Of Subfloor Damage
Uneven flooring, creaking sounds, or visible sagging may indicate subfloor issues.
Reasons For Replacement
Subfloor replacement might be needed after water damage, mold growth, or structural deterioration.
Benefits Of Replacement
Replacing the subfloor can improve floor stability, prevent further damage, and enhance indoor comfort.

Common Subfloor Replacement Jobs
Subfloor Replacement - involves removing damaged or rotted subflooring and installing new material to restore stability.
Water Damage Repair - addresses subfloor issues caused by leaks or flooding to prevent further structural problems.
Foundation Support - replaces compromised subfloor sections to ensure proper load distribution and prevent sagging.
Home Renovation Projects - includes subfloor replacement as part of remodeling or upgrading interior spaces.
Pest Damage Restoration - replaces subfloor sections affected by termites or other pests to maintain home integrity.
Structural Repair - involves removing and replacing subfloor sections to fix sagging or uneven flooring surfaces.
Subfloor Replacement Questions
What are signs that subfloor replacement is needed? Indicators include uneven flooring, persistent squeaks, or visible damage beneath the surface.
Can subfloor replacement be done in sections or is full replacement necessary? Replacement can be partial or complete, depending on the extent of damage and project needs.
What types of flooring can be installed after subfloor replacement? Various flooring options like hardwood, laminate, tile, or carpet can be installed once the subfloor is prepared.
Is subfloor replacement suitable for residential or commercial properties? It is applicable for both homes and commercial buildings experiencing subfloor issues.
